Teach Yourself to Play the Folk Harp, by Sylvia Woods - book $13.95
This has become the standard beginning book for folk harp players. Each of the 12 lessons includes instructions, exercises, and folk and classical pieces using the new skills and techniques taught in the lesson. This excellent book has 44 pieces all in key of C; no sharping levers are required.

The Harp Plays, by Betsy Goodspeed - book/CD $24.95
This book teaches harp students to be musicians an well as harpers. Songs were written to teach players to read intervals, recognize parallel patterns and use chord progressions. Introductions to ambient music and fake sheets complete a simple repertoire that incudes commercial songs such as Theme from Exodus, Charade, and Try to Remember. The 50 page method has a companion CD of the music and concludes with samples from Betsy's other CD's to inspire those who want to play pop music, sing with the harp, or learn to improvise.

Music Theory and Arranging for Folk Harps, by Sylvia Woods - book $18.95

This book teaches harpers at any level the music theory and techniques they need to make theor own arrangements. Subjects covered include chords, keys, inversions, transposing, accompaniment patterns, and more. There are many examples and more than 90 pieces on which the student can practice their newly gained skills. Most pieces are in C.

Arranging For Folk Harp, by Kim Robertson - book $10.95
Imaginative use of chords to accompany a melody is the key to creative harp arrangement. This illustrates a variety of accompaniment patterns & arranging techniques for harpers. First part is a beginner's basic guide to chords, accompaniment patterns, arranging techniques, all in the key of C, including Pachelbel's Canon.The second part includes chord variations,arrangement ideas, special effects, and steps for successful arranging.

The Small Harp - a step by step tutor, by Alison Kinnaird - book/CD set $24.95
Alison Kinnaird is one of Scotland's leading clarsach (small harp) players. This 90-page tutorial is a great way to begin learning the harp, especially for those interested in learning Scottish or Irish ornamentation. There are basic lessons, exercises, simple to advanced ornamentation techniques, and 40 tunes, from elementary to advanced (in key of C or sharp keys).

Alternative Tunings for the Lever Harp:
How to Fully Utilize Your Levers, by Aedan MacDonnell - book $4.95

There are several ways to tune your lever harp to take full advantage of your sharping levers. This handy new reference book takes the mystery out of levers, tuning, and keys. With its simple yet powerful diagrams, this lever guide was written especially for those without an understanding of basic music theory. 22 pages.
